A Halloween-themed 5k and Fun Run involving a costume contest and candy treats along the course. This is a unique themed-run which celebrates health, an active lifestyle and the changing of the seasons while getting to still eat some chocolate! Each participant will be given a Halloween Monster Dash candy bag and there will be several candy stations along the course to gather candy. Now how fun is that…
This event is less about your minute per mile time, but more about having the time of your life. The fun run is un-timed (although we know some will be racing for a time and that is fine) and less about who finishes first! It’s about dressing up in the craziest, scariest and most creative costumes on the planet and coming out to do some exercising and collecting some candy along the way! What better way for a family to go trick or treat and have a healthy experience. Or for all those who are going to make a day of it what better way than to dress up with your roommates or training partners, have some fun for a couple of hours and then you’re right in the heart of the entertainment district and the night is still young!
Intersection of Church and Center Streets is the start/finish line. The expo is located in the one section of the parking lots between Church and Mountain Streets. We encourage car pooling, walking or biking where possible. Parking can be a challenge in the downtown area, but there are several public lots to choose from. You can also park in the Town Center garage parking lot and United Methodist Church parking deck just to name a few.
The whole reason for dressing up is to see who is the most creative…right! There will be judges (if you can call them that) who will be looking for the most creative, scariest and wildest costumes. The top costumes in five categories: individual, 2-person, 3-person, 4+ person and Owner/Pet will be judged at the costume contest at the end.
